As adults, it can be hard for us to find the time, energy, or motivation to start a new habit, even one that ultimately will make us feel better and perhaps even regain that energy we lack. When starting your own research into healthy eating and realizing how much is out there, it can feel like an impossible mountain to climb. Wouldn’t this have all been easier if we could have learned this in school? 

Let’s talk about some research being done in schools doing just that. We review some methods used by researchers to encourage healthier eating habits in schools. Let’s see what works and what doesn’t.
